time_t clock_t

关于time_t,clock_t ,time(),clock(),CLK_TCK, CLOCKS_PER_SEC 的使用
2007-03-29 21:28

ISO/IEC     9899:1999     标准中有一个宏:     CLOCKS_PER_SEC   

    <1>     tc2     中的     time.h:没有     CLOCKS_PER_SEC,有一个     CLK_TCK   
                                              #define     CLK_TCK     18.2   
    <2>     gcc     中的     time.h:#define     CLOCKS_PER_SEC     ((clock_t)1000)   
                                              #define     CLK_TCK         CLOCKS_PER_SEC   

 

time返回从1970年1月1日到现在的秒数,是实际时间;

clock()得到的是毫秒做单位的,time()得到的是秒做单位的。

函数名:       clock     
      功       能:       确定处理器时间     
      用       法:       clock_t       clock(void);     
      程序例:     
    
      #include       <time.h>     
      #include       <stdio.h>     
      #include       <dos.h>     
    
      int       main(void)     
      {     
      clock_t       start,       end;     
      start       =       clock();     
    
      delay(2000); //MS VC 6.0 中可用_sleep() 代替delay,header:stdlib.h/iostream或Sleep()

//,header:windows.h
    
      end       =       clock();     
      printf("The       time       was:       %f/n",       (end       -       start)       /       CLK_TCK);     
    
      return       0;     
      }

 

      函数名:       time       
      功         能:       取一天的时间       
      用         法:       logn       time(long       *tloc);       
      程序例:       
    
      #include         
      #include         
      #include         
    
      int       main(void)       
      {       
            time_t       t;       
    
            t       =       time(NULL);       
            printf("The       number       of       seconds       since       January       1,       1970       is       %ld",t);       
            return       0;       
      }       
          

转载http://hi.baidu.com/sysucs/blog/item/3b9852365e8d06dca3cc2bd1.html

  • 0
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 2
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值